NIC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review

74 of the 4,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Nicolet Bankshares (NIC)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$203M — up 25% from $163M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 11 funds opened new NIC positions and 4 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 25 added to existing stakes and 24 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Legacy Private Trust, opening a new position worth an estimated $1.45M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$1.27M.
